This recruitment drive is for the direct recruitment of technical personnel into a prestigious central government organization based on a valid GATE score.
| Feature | Details |
| Post Name | Deputy Field Officer (Technical) |
| Post Classification | Group ‘B’, Non-Gazetted |
| Total Vacancies | 250 (Tentative) |
| Salary (Approx.) | ₹99,000/- per month (for New Delhi posting) |
| Pay Level | Level-7 in Pay Matrix (Basic Pay: ₹44,900 to ₹1,42,400) |
| Application Mode | Offline (via Ordinary Post ONLY) |
| Application Deadline | 14.12.2025 (Date of receipt of application) |
| Job Requirement | All India Transfer liability, may include difficult field postings. |
The eligibility criteria are strictly based on educational qualification and a valid GATE score.
| Criteria | Requirement |
| Educational Qualification | B.E./B.Tech. OR M.Sc. in one of the specified subjects from a recognised University/Institution. |
| GATE Score | Must possess a valid GATE Score Card from GATE 2023, 2024, or 2025 in the corresponding subject paper. |
| Age Limit | Not to exceed 30 years as of the closing date (14.12.2025). |
| Age Relaxation | Applicable for SC/ST/OBC, Central Government Employees, and Ex-servicemen as per Central Government rules. |

The remuneration is highly competitive, falling under Level-7 of the 7th CPC.
Pay Level 7: Basic Pay ranges from ₹44,900 to ₹1,42,400.
Total Emoluments: Approximately ₹99,000/- per month (for a posting in New Delhi).
Allowances Package: The ₹99,000 figure includes a comprehensive package of allowances such as:
Dearness Allowance (DA)
House Rent Allowance (HRA) (Varies by city)
Transport Allowance (TA)
Other Benefits: Entitlement to Central Government perks like National Pension System (NPS), Medical facilities (CGHS), and Leave Travel Concession (LTC).
The selection is a two-stage, merit-based process without a separate written examination.
Shortlisting via GATE Score:
Applications will be sorted based on the valid GATE score (2023, 2024, or 2025) for the respective subject.
Candidates must have achieved the qualifying cut-off marks in their GATE paper.
Candidates will be shortlisted for the interview in a ratio of 1:5 (five candidates for every one vacancy).
Personal Interview:
Shortlisted candidates will be called for an Interview.
Final Selection is based on the combined performance in the GATE examination and the Personal Interview.
Interview Centres: Candidates can choose a preferred centre from: Chennai, Gurugram, Guwahati, Jammu, Jodhpur, Kolkata, Lucknow, and Mumbai.
Note: Final selection is subject to fulfilling all eligibility criteria, Character & Antecedent verification, and a Medical Examination.

The second and final stage is the Personal Interview. The 'syllabus' for this stage is broader and covers your technical expertise, general awareness, and personal attributes essential for a central government DFO role.
Deep Subject Knowledge: Expect questions from your final year/core subjects and the subjects relevant to your GATE paper. You must be able to apply theoretical concepts to practical scenarios.
B.Tech/M.Sc Project: Thorough knowledge of your academic projects, internships, and any work experience is crucial, especially regarding the technical challenges and solutions involved.
Domain Specifics: Be prepared to discuss current technologies and their application in the relevant field (e.g., Cyber Security trends for CS/IT, or advanced communication systems for E&TC).
